Job Description

Job Description:

1.       Follow the , policies and procedures applicable now and from time to time and adherence to line of authority;

2.       Be an effective organizational leader and a key member of operation management in line with the policies and procedures and management decisions;

3.       Act as Acting Chief Operation Officer in absence of Chief Operation Officer – COO provided he is being referred by COO to do so.

Principal accountabilities are:

1.       Project a professional and warm image; maintain operational control based on section’s reports and continuous improvement in operation efficiency.

2.       Manage reporting sections functions to ensure the delivery of quality service to customers.

3.       Rectify internal control issues according to internal and external audit reports.

4.       Insure strict adherence to laid down procedures and avoid breach of compliance.

5.       Reporting sections direction toward the section’s given targets.

6.       Assist in formulating the bank’s future direction and supporting tactical initiatives

7.       Monitor and direct the implementation of strategic business plans

8.       Assist the COO in development of Operational strategies/plans

9.       Maintain in-depth relations with all departments of the bank

10.    Implement instructions referred/instructed by the Chief Operation Officer

11.    Manage the following sections:, 3131 Call center, Western Union, Salary, payments and branchless banking.

12.    Oversee the issuance of management reporting and report operational results to Chief Operation Officer.

13.    Prepare operation related reports (data acquired from sections) required by Da Afghanistan Bank

14.    Acquire bank reconciliations prepared by related sections according to the board decision on timely basis.

15.    Monitor cash management of the bank,ensure that cash positions of all branches are in line with the requirement and approval and assist treasury in managing investments by taking into account, customer cash requirements, ensure management of accounts with financial institutions.

16.    Authorize transactions of the head office related sections.

17.    Any other tasks given by the COO and Board of Management.

Qualification:

1.       Bachelors In Business Administration – Economics, Finance and Management or relevant degree. (Must)

2.       Masters In Business Administration (Preferred)

3.       Relevant prior experience of minimum five years with  2 years as general manager in bank operation. (Must)
